What You Will Do:

  • Lead Companys public sector policy strategy at the federal, state, and local levels, working in close partnership with public sector sales to support strategic business development

  • Build and maintain high-level relationships with policymakers, agency leaders, procurement officials, trade associations, and public policy influencers to drive awareness and demand for Companys solutions.

  • Drive budget and appropriation outcomes with Federal, State and Local leaders

  • Develop joint-research opportunities and partnerships with think tanks and academic institutions that enhance the companys credibility and business growth in the public sector.

  • Represent Companies in trade associations and policy forums to position the company as a leader in cybersecurity ratings and trusted risk intelligence.

  • Draft thought leadership pieces and policy-facing content to elevate Companys brand visibility in public sector markets.

  • Stay informed on federal and state legislative and regulatory developments to help shape and inform public sector go-to-market strategy.

  • Manage external consultants and advisors in both policy advocacy and public sector market development activities.

  • Advise Company senior leadership on public sector trends, emerging opportunities, and strategic investments.

  • Partner with Product and Marketing teams to provide feedback from public sector stakeholders on evolving needs and potential product enhancements.
